diff options
author | joerg <joerg> | 2009-04-04 19:07:58 +0000 |
---|---|---|
committer | joerg <joerg> | 2009-04-04 19:07:58 +0000 |
commit | 0a236b55a93d1c9a90e59f950715b8fa67834a09 (patch) | |
tree | a428a73188c3f575532fbb11084705c81d182825 /mk | |
parent | bd67aacf6892d7e2f6211f7b47240ffee6754fa6 (diff) | |
download | pkgsrc-0a236b55a93d1c9a90e59f950715b8fa67834a09.tar.gz |
Tell the user the right config file and option for vulnerabilities based
on the pkg_install version. Reported by Nicolas Joly.
Diffstat (limited to 'mk')
-rw-r--r-- | mk/flavor/pkg/check.mk | 4 | ||||
-rw-r--r-- | mk/flavor/pkg/flavor-vars.mk | 6 |
2 files changed, 7 insertions, 3 deletions
diff --git a/mk/flavor/pkg/check.mk b/mk/flavor/pkg/check.mk index 287c4a45d94..235fbe2ba9b 100644 --- a/mk/flavor/pkg/check.mk +++ b/mk/flavor/pkg/check.mk @@ -1,4 +1,4 @@ -# $NetBSD: check.mk,v 1.12 2009/03/20 16:52:40 joerg Exp $ +# $NetBSD: check.mk,v 1.13 2009/04/04 19:07:58 joerg Exp $ # # _flavor-check-vulnerable: @@ -21,5 +21,5 @@ _flavor-check-vulnerable: .PHONY fi; \ ${PHASE_MSG} "Checking for vulnerabilities in ${PKGNAME}"; \ ${AUDIT_PACKAGES} ${_AUDIT_PACKAGES_CMD} ${AUDIT_PACKAGES_FLAGS} ${PKGNAME} \ - || ${FAIL_MSG} "Define ALLOW_VULNERABLE_PACKAGES in mk.conf or IGNORE_URLS in audit-packages.conf(5) if this package is absolutely essential." + || ${FAIL_MSG} "Define ALLOW_VULNERABLE_PACKAGES in mk.conf or ${_AUDIT_CONFIG_OPTION} in ${_AUDIT_CONFIG_FILE}(5) if this package is absolutely essential." .endif diff --git a/mk/flavor/pkg/flavor-vars.mk b/mk/flavor/pkg/flavor-vars.mk index bab8ea2d481..80c453211e3 100644 --- a/mk/flavor/pkg/flavor-vars.mk +++ b/mk/flavor/pkg/flavor-vars.mk @@ -1,4 +1,4 @@ -# $NetBSD: flavor-vars.mk,v 1.11 2009/03/20 16:52:40 joerg Exp $ +# $NetBSD: flavor-vars.mk,v 1.12 2009/04/04 19:07:58 joerg Exp $ # # This Makefile fragment is included indirectly by bsd.prefs.mk and # defines some variables which must be defined earlier than where @@ -54,11 +54,15 @@ AUDIT_PACKAGES?= ${PKG_ADMIN} _AUDIT_PACKAGES_CMD?= audit-pkg _EXTRACT_PKGVULNDIR= ${PKG_ADMIN} config-var PKGVULNDIR DOWNLOAD_VULN_LIST?= ${PKG_ADMIN} fetch-pkg-vulnerabilities +_AUDIT_CONFIG_FILE= pkg_install.conf +_AUDIT_CONFIG_OPTION= IGNORE_URL .else AUDIT_PACKAGES?= ${PKG_TOOLS_BIN}/audit-packages _AUDIT_PACKAGES_CMD?= -n _EXTRACT_PKGVULNDIR= ${AUDIT_PACKAGES} ${AUDIT_PACKAGES_FLAGS} -Q PKGVULNDIR DOWNLOAD_VULN_LIST?= ${PKG_TOOLS_BIN}/download-vulnerability-list +_AUDIT_CONFIG_FILE= audit-packages.conf +_AUDIT_CONFIG_OPTION= IGNORE_URLS .endif |